Blackburn Rovers boss Steve Kean admits they've been working on Nikola Kalinic's confidence.
The Croatia striker is weighing up his future at Ewood Park.
"Niko has responded well. He's been frustrated, he's not been on the pitch too much," Kean told the Lancashire Telegraph.
"We put on an extra session, getting him hit the back again. He's looking sharp.
"Hopefully Niko is in a mental place where he can put it all together. He mustn't feel like he's on trial.
"He mustn't think he has one game to score a hat-trick or he'll never play for the club again."
